Marcin Budkowski is a Polish Formula One engineer. He is currently the executive director at the Alpine Formula One team.

Marcin Budkowski joined the team in April 2018, following roles at Prost GP, Ferrari, McLaren and the Féderation Internationale de l’Automobile (FIA).

He graduated from École Polytechnique, Paris, in 1999 and continued his studies between 1999 and 2001 at the Institut Supérieur de l’Aéronautique et de l’Espace (ISAE SUPAERO) and Imperial College London, specialising in Aeronautics and Aerodynamics.

After completing his studies, Marcin Budkowski started his career in motorsport in 2001 as an aerodynamicist for Prost GP. Budkowski subsequently moved to Maranello, working for Ferrari between 2002 and 2007 in a period that saw the team winning multiple championships.

He then joined McLaren in 2007, working in a range of technical roles both at the factory and at the track, notably during the 2008 title-winning year, before becoming Head of Aerodynamics in 2012. His seven years at McLaren finished in 2014 when he joined the FIA to become Charlie Whiting’s right-hand man, initially as Formula 1’s Technical and Sporting Coordinator, subsequently becoming Head of the Formula One Technical Department in 2017.

Marcin is based at the team’s headquarters in Enstone, Oxfordshire, United Kingdom. He oversees the running of the Alpine F1 Team, leads the teams responsible for the development, production and operation of the car and ensures good alignment and collaboration between the Chassis and Power Unit entities. He represents the team at the F1 Commission and contributes to its overall strategy, working closely with Laurent to ensure the team meets its objectives.

In January 2021 he was made a director of the Alpine F1 Team.

Marcin is fluent in four languages: Polish, English, French and Italian.
